Baidu, Inc. said its voluntary conversion from secondary to dual-primary listing on the Main Board of The Stock Exchange of Hong Kong Limited became effective on September 1, 2026, making the Beijing-based AI company dual-primary listed in Hong Kong and on the Nasdaq Global Select Market.
